Meeting Jauffre and Presenting the Amulet

After receiving the Amulet of Kings, your next destination is Weynon Priory, located near Chorrol. Once there, speak with Jauffre, a member of the Blades and trusted advisor to the late Emperor. When prompted, present the amulet. His reaction confirms the artifact’s authenticity and its critical role in the Empire’s survival. Jauffre quickly realizes the implications and begins to trust your story, unusual though it sounds.

During this conversation, you'll learn more about the Emperor's final moments and his cryptic message about closing "the jaws of Oblivion." Jauffre introduces you to the growing threat from Mehrunes Dagon, a Daedric Prince, and hints that the magical barriers separating Oblivion from Tamriel may be weakening.




Understanding the Role of the Amulet and the Imperial Heir

Jauffre explains that the Amulet of Kings is not just a relic; it’s used during coronation ceremonies to ignite the Dragonfires at the Temple of the One. These fires serve as a protective seal between the mortal world and the demonic plane. With the Emperor dead and no crowned heir, the Dragonfires are extinguished, leaving the realm vulnerable.

He reveals a closely guarded secret: Uriel Septim had an illegitimate son named Martin, who now serves as a priest in the city of Kvatch. Jauffre believes Martin may be the only surviving heir to the throne. Your task now is to locate Martin and bring him back to Weynon Priory before enemy forces find him first.

Preparing for the Journey to Kvatch

Before leaving Weynon Priory, take advantage of the resources Jauffre offers. He provides access to a chest containing basic gear—armor, weapons, and healing items—useful for the journey ahead. While supplies are limited, they can offer a solid starting boost, especially if you haven’t upgraded your equipment yet.

Kvatch lies to the south of Chorrol, but the path there isn’t safe. You’ll encounter enemies along the road, and Oblivion Gates may already be affecting the region. Make sure to save your game frequently, repair your gear, and keep potions ready for combat situations.


Why Kvatch Matters in the Main Storyline

Kvatch becomes a central location early in the main questline. It's not only where Martin is found but also the site of one of the first major Oblivion Gate events. When you arrive, the city is under siege, and the devastation is clear. This encounter provides your first direct look at the Oblivion threat.

Finding Martin inside the chapel is your main goal. You must first assist the remaining guards and citizens to reclaim part of the city. Only after helping to secure the area will you be able to approach Martin and speak with him. Your choices during these events will shape how the early game unfolds and how allies perceive your character.




Rescuing Martin and Gaining His Trust

After reaching the Chapel of Akatosh in Kvatch, you'll find Martin among the survivors. He appears calm and skeptical, unaware of his royal bloodline. Speaking to him about the Emperor and the Amulet of Kings will eventually convince him of the situation’s urgency. However, Martin won’t leave immediately—he insists on helping defend what remains of Kvatch first.

Participate in the effort to push back the Daedra and help close the Oblivion Gate nearby. This part of the mission includes intense combat and the first deeper look into Oblivion’s terrifying landscapes. Once the threat is reduced, Martin agrees to leave the city and travel with you to Weynon Priory.


Returning to Weynon Priory With Martin

With Martin now at your side, escort him safely back to Weynon Priory. Watch for potential ambushes on the road. While Martin can defend himself to a degree, it's your responsibility to ensure his safety.

Upon arrival, Jauffre officially acknowledges Martin as Uriel Septim’s heir. This marks a major turning point in the story. From this moment on, protecting Martin becomes your top mission. The next steps will focus on understanding how to relight the Dragonfires and how to stop the Oblivion invasion.

What Comes Next in the Main Quest

The “Deliver the Amulet” quest concludes by officially introducing Martin as the rightful heir to the Septim throne. From this point, the story expands as you assist the Blades and Martin in planning how to relight the Dragonfires and stop the Daedric threat.

This sets the stage for key missions involving the Mythic Dawn cult, Oblivion Gates, and ancient artifacts. With Martin revealed and the amulet secure, you are now fully engaged in the fight to preserve the Empire.
